If you attempt to contact the originator of the debt, they will just refer you to their collection agent. They cannot negotiate with you once they own given the debt to a collection agency because most collection agencies bind the companies to a non-circumvent contract.

Paying off a debt that has be charged off or sent to collections will not significantly increase your credit score. After it have aged for a while, then it's weight on your credit mark won't be so heavy and your score will increase slightly.

The original creditor is unlikely to remove the item from your report.
